Leaving a vehicle in storage can be a silent killer for its battery. Parasitic drains and self-discharge slowly sap the life from lead-acid and lithium-ion cells, leading to the frustration of a dead battery when you’re ready to hit the road again. A simple trickle charger can often overcharge and damage the battery over the long term, causing more harm than good.
The solution is a modern battery maintainer, also known as a battery tender or float charger. These smart devices provide a precise, automated charge cycle. They deliver power only when needed to maintain a full charge and then switch to a safe maintenance mode, preventing sulfation and extending your battery’s lifespan. Buying Guide: How to Pick the Right Auto Battery Maintainer for Long-Term Storage
When I need to store a car for a while, the last thing I want is to come back to a dead battery. That’s where a good auto battery maintainer comes in. It’s not just a fancy trickle charger; it’s a smart device designed to keep your battery at an optimal charge level without cooking it. But with so many options, how do you choose the right one? Let me walk you through what I look for.
First, you need to understand the difference between a charger and a maintainer. A charger is meant to get a low or dead battery back to full power, often quickly. A maintainer, sometimes called a float charger or battery tender, is for long-term care. Once it brings your battery to a full charge, it switches to a maintenance mode, delivering tiny pulses of power only when needed to keep it at 100%. This prevents overcharging and sulfation, which are the two main killers of batteries in storage. For long-term storage, a maintainer is absolutely the right tool for the job.
Next, consider the battery type. Most cars use standard flooded lead-acid batteries, but many modern vehicles have AGM (Absorbent Glass Mat) or EFB (Enhanced Flooded Battery) types, and some even have lithium. A high-quality maintainer will have specific modes or be compatible with these different chemistries. Using a maintainer not designed for your battery type can damage it. I always check the product specifications to ensure it lists compatibility with my vehicle’s battery.
Another key feature is the connection method. You’ll typically find models with alligator clips, which are great for occasional use, or with ring terminal connectors that you can permanently install on the battery terminals. For a true long-term storage setup, the ring terminals are the way to go. It makes connecting and disconnecting a simple, spark-free process. Just pop the hood, plug in the maintainer, and you’re done. It’s much more convenient than fiddling with clips every time.
Finally, look for important safety certifications and features. A maintainer with a UL listing or ETL certification has been independently tested for safety, which gives me a lot of peace of mind when leaving it plugged in for months. Features like spark-proof technology, reverse polarity protection, and weather resistance are also huge pluses. I don’t want a little mistake to cause a big problem, and if the maintainer is going to be near the car, it needs to handle a damp garage environment. By focusing on these aspects—smart maintenance technology, battery compatibility, secure connections, and robust safety—you can confidently select one of the best auto battery maintainers for long-term storage.
Frequently Asked Questions
Can I use a battery maintainer on a completely dead battery?
Most smart battery maintainers are designed to work on batteries that have some voltage left, but they often won’t start if the battery is completely drained, or “flat.” This is a safety feature. If a battery reads below a certain voltage threshold (often around 9-10 volts for a 12V battery), the maintainer might consider it damaged or unsalvageable and will not engage. If your battery is totally dead, you might need a traditional charger to give it a initial boost before switching over to a maintainer for the long-term storage.
How long can I safely leave a battery maintainer connected?
This is the whole point of a quality maintainer! You can safely leave it connected indefinitely. Once the battery reaches a full charge, the device switches into its maintenance or float mode. In this state, it effectively goes to sleep, monitoring the battery voltage and only providing a tiny trickle of power when it detects a small drop. I’ve left my vehicles on a maintainer for entire winters, six months or more, with no issues. It’s a “set it and forget it” solution, as long as you’re using a modern, smart unit.
What’s the difference between a 1-amp and a 2-amp maintainer?
The amp rating indicates the maximum rate at which the device can charge the battery. For long-term storage and maintenance, a lower amp rating like 1 amp or 1.5 amps is actually perfect. It provides a slow, gentle charge that is very healthy for the battery. A 2-amp model will charge a little faster initially, but once in maintenance mode, both will behave very similarly. For a standard car battery, either is fine. The key is that it’s a smart maintainer, not the maximum amperage.
Is it safe to use a maintainer in an enclosed space like a garage?
Generally, yes, but you should always check the manufacturer’s instructions. Modern maintainers are very safe and generate very little heat. However, any electrical device carries a minimal risk. To be extra safe, ensure the area is well-ventilated, especially if your battery is a traditional flooded type that can off-gas hydrogen under certain conditions. Using a maintainer with safety certifications like UL listing greatly reduces any risk, making it suitable for garage use.
Do I need to disconnect the battery from my car to use a maintainer?
This is a common question. For most modern maintainers, you do not need to disconnect the battery from the vehicle. The small amount of power used for maintenance is negligible and shouldn’t affect the car’s electronics. In fact, it can help keep the memory settings in your radio and computer alive. However, if you are storing a classic car or a vehicle you are particularly concerned about, consulting your owner’s manual or disconnecting the battery is a safe, conservative approach. For everyday use on a modern car, connecting it directly is standard practice and one of the main benefits of using a dedicated maintainer.
Will a maintainer work on other types of batteries, like for a lawnmower or motorcycle?
Absolutely. One of the great things about a small, smart maintainer is its versatility. The same unit you use for your car can typically be used on motorcycles, lawn tractors, ATVs, and even marine batteries. Just make sure the maintainer is rated for 12-volt batteries (which most small engines use) and that you select the correct mode if it has different settings for battery types like AGM. This makes a single maintainer a fantastic tool for maintaining all the batteries in your garage during the off-season.
